Metsera, Inc. (NASDAQ:MTSR - Get Free Report) fell 7.6% during trading on Monday . The stock traded as low as $23.55 and last traded at $23.70. 169,960 shares were traded during mid-day trading, a decline of 80% from the average session volume of 866,117 shares. The stock had previously closed at $25.65.

Metsera Company Profile
(
Get Free Report)
Metsera, Inc is a clinical stage biopharmaceutical company, which engages in the development of a next-generation injectable and oral nutrient stimulated hormone, or NuSH, analog peptides to treat obesity, overweight and related conditions. Its product pipeline includes MET-097i, MET-233, and MET-224o.
